Basic Information

Product Name Dihydroxyacetonedimer
CAS No. 23147-59-3
Molecular Formula C6H12O6
Molecular Weight 180.16 g/mol
Synonyms 1,3-Dihydroxy-2-propanone dimer; Dihydroxyacetone Dimer; Glycerone Dimer; 2,5-Bis(hydroxymethyl)-1,4-dioxane-2,5-diol; DHA Dimer; 1,4-Dioxane-2,5-dimethanol, 2,5-dihydroxy-; (2,5-Dihydroxy-1,4-dioxane-2,5-diyl)dimethanol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ic and easily oxidized nature, it is recommended to handle under an inert atmosphere for extended storage and to minimize exposure to moisture.
